Our mindsets determine our attitudes. A wrong mindset leads to a bad attitude. But if our minds are set on God and His word, our attitude will become godly. This is the devotion today: Set your minds on things above.”  Scripture said in Colossians 3:2, “Set your minds on things above, not on earthly things.” This is an exhortation to fix your mind on Christ, who you are in Him, His spiritual blessings, and His purposes for your life. This is how we discover the life we have in Jesus, a life different from the people of the world with all their ungodly standards and sinful practices.  There is an element of spiritual struggle here, mainly because a real born-again believer of Christ still has the old sinful self with its thoughts, desires, and ungodly patterns and behaviors. When Paul said, "Set your minds on things above, not on earthly things" (Colossians 3:2), he admits the reality of an inward transition. We must put to death, therefore, the old self with its sinful attitudes and mindsets such as pride, but must clothe ourselves with compassion, kindness, humility, gentleness,  patience, forgiveness, unity, and peace (Colossians 3:5-15). God made this possible to a life of faith for the Holy Spirit indwells us. We must submit and ask for His help. God’s Spirit uses the Bible, to renew our minds and put to death our sinful selves for true godliness and holiness. So set your minds on being loving, kind, compassionate, self-control and all godlinessthrough constant submission to God’s Spirit. Where is your mind settled, on the earthly or eternal? When a person is settled on accumulating earthly possessions, for example, the mind is set on forever discontent. But when one is fixed on being content with God, the mind is thankful for what God gave us.  Remember, our mindsets reflect our value system. Our value systems determine our character. In our character lies the strength and weakness in facing the various challenges in this temporal world. May God’s Spirit help you set your mind on the things above as you constantly meditate on God’s word.
